Data from Baldwin Locomotive Works Specification for Engines as digitized by the DeGolyer Library of Southern Methodist University Volume 12, , p. 56 . Works number was 7335 in June 1884.
This was one of the tank engines that headed up passenger traffic from the terminal in Brooklyn near the bridge to Coney Island. The Sea Beach Line was electrified in 1898 and the Coney Island put in mothballs. In 1899, the 3 found new employment on the very short (2.15 miles) Milford, Matamoros & New York Railroad and ran until 1917.
